About Color #CA528B (#CA528B)
#CA528B is a pink color (colour) with RGB channel values of 202 red, 82 green, and 139 blue. The red channel is dominant by a ratio of 2.5:1 over the weakest channel. In HSL terms, the hue sits at 332 degrees with 53% saturation and 56% lightness, placing it in the warm range of the colour spectrum.
The perceived brightness of #CA528B is 124/255 using the ITU-R BT.601 luma formula (0.299R + 0.587G + 0.114B). This appears dark to the human eye, so pair it with light text for adequate readability. For print production, the CMYK equivalent is 0% cyan, 59% magenta, 31% yellow, and 21% key (black).
The WCAG contrast ratio of #CA528B against white is 4.12:1 and against black is 5.09:1. This only passes AA for large text (18pt+) on white. For normal body text on white, darken the color or use it on a dark background where it achieves 5.09:1.
The complementary colour #53CA93 creates maximum visual tension when paired with #CA528B. For more harmonious color combinations, use the analogous colours #CA53C6 and #CA5753, which sit 30 degrees on either side of the hue wheel. What is HEX to RGB, HSL, CMYK color conversion
Converting from HEX to RGB, HSL, CMYK translates a color value between two different color models. Different color models are used in web design (HEX, RGB), print (CMYK), and color theory (HSL, HSV).
